$ .ajax成功:函数在接收答案时什么都不做

时间:2012-08-06 13:51:56

标签: php ajax jquery

现在这让我困扰了2个多小时,我只是看不到它。

我有一个表单,它在PHP中验证它。所以我所做的是根据我提交的返回响应创建一个AJAX调用,或者不提交表单。这是我的AJAX电话:

    $("#savePO").click(function() {
        $.ajax({
            type : 'POST',
            url : 'ajax/newpo_check_ajax.php',
            data : $("#newpoform").serialize(),
            succes : function(respons) {
                alert(respons);
            }

        });
});

响应页面(newpo_check_ajax.php)只是:

<?php
echo "AJAX IS WORKING!";
?>

当我检查Firebug时,它表示响应确实应该是什么(“AJAX正在工作!”),但无论我尝试什么,我都没有得到响应警报!

上面的jQuery代码位于我的页面底部,因为它在顶部不起作用(在$(document).ready())内。

任何帮助表示赞赏! :)

编辑:不幸的是我再也无法正常阅读了。我忘记了一个成功的S,在那个。

2 个答案:

答案 0 :(得分:5)

正确的拼写是success,而不是succes。你最后错过了s

答案 1 :(得分:1)

你用一个人写“成功”,因为它应该是“成功”